133 MHz synchronous SRAM — timing and organization

The CY7C1328G-133AXIT is a 4.5 Mbit synchronous SRAM organized as 256K x 18 bits. The 18-bit word width is useful for systems that need a parity or ECC check bit alongside each 16-bit data word — a common pattern in networking and telecom line cards where single-bit error detection is non-negotiable.
